Fresno State slugger Jordan Ribera headlines a group of college power hitters who will compete in the inaugural TD AMERITRADE College Home Run Derby.

The Home Run Derby will be held at Omaha's Rosenblatt Stadium on Wednesday, July 7 at 5:30 pm. CBS will air the event nationwide on Sunday, July 11 from 10 a.m. to noon.

Ribera led the nation with 27 home runs. He batted .343 in 63 games as a junior first baseman for Fresno State.

Of course, Ribera is no stranger to Rosenblatt Stadium either. He hit memorable home runs against Rice University and the University of Georgia during Fresno State's improbable national championship run in the 2008 College World Series.

Joining Ribera and Siena College slugger Dan Paolini in Omaha will be Matt Gaudet (Louisiana State University/Sr./DH), Matt Skole (Georgia Tech/Soph./IF) and Steven Felix (Troy University/Sr./C).

The collegiate home run hitting competition will feature eight of the nation's premier power hitters facing off in an elimination-style format. Two more players will be announced to complete the field of eight later this week.
